amazonka-mediaconvert-2.0: Amazon Elemental MediaConvert SDK.
Copyright(c) 2013-2023 Brendan Hay
LicenseMozilla Public License, v. 2.0.
MaintainerBrendan Hay
Stabilityauto-generated
Portabilitynon-portable (GHC extensions)
Safe HaskellSafe-Inferred
LanguageHaskell2010

Amazonka.MediaConvert.Types.AccelerationSettings

Description

 
Synopsis

Documentation

data AccelerationSettings Source #

Accelerated transcoding can significantly speed up jobs with long, visually complex content.

See: newAccelerationSettings smart constructor.

Constructors

AccelerationSettings' 

Fields

  • mode :: AccelerationMode

    Specify the conditions when the service will run your job with accelerated transcoding.

Instances

Instances details
FromJSON A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

ToJSON A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

Generic A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

Associated Types

type Rep AccelerationSettings :: Type -> Type #

Read A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

Show A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

NFData A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

Methods

rnf :: AccelerationSettings -> () #

Eq A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

Hashable A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

type Rep AccelerationSettings Source # 
Instance details

Defined in Amazonka.MediaConvert.Types.AccelerationSettings

type Rep AccelerationSettings = D1 ('MetaData "AccelerationSettings" "Amazonka.MediaConvert.Types.AccelerationSettings" "amazonka-mediaconvert-2.0-ClG8xHhlx4y6bdaCrZchqH" 'False) (C1 ('MetaCons "AccelerationSettings'" 'PrefixI 'True) (S1 ('MetaSel ('Just "mode")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 AccelerationMode)))

newAccelerationSettings Source #

Create a value of AccelerationSettings with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

$sel:mode:AccelerationSettings', accelerationSettings_mode - Specify the conditions when the service will run your job with accelerated transcoding.

accelerationSettings_mode :: Lens' AccelerationSettings AccelerationMode Source #

Specify the conditions when the service will run your job with accelerated transcoding.